Chapter 14: Q14.124 P (page 624)
Select the stronger bond in each pair:
(a) Cl-Cl or Br-Br
(b) Br-Br or I-I
(c) F-F or Cl-Cl.
Why doesn't the F-F bond strength follow the group trend?
Short Answer
(a) Cl-Cl
(b) Br-Br
(c) Cl-Cl
